* 1st game at Footy Park - the Lions are used to winning there, but I cannot imagine a more challening way to start the season.

* 2nd game vs the Roos - a bitter game to be sure & I can't wait. Hope the Lions take it up physically & blow them away. It's about time we had a win againt them.

* the injury count at the completion of the RR in the Ansett cup.

* seeing if Des Headland can make it in AFL. Watch out if he does, as IMO he probably has more raw talent than any other young player in the League.

* Michael Voss going into a season without pre season injuries hampering his preparation. He was pretty awesome with a steel rod in his leg, without one he will be a brownlow favourite.

* Seeing who can hold down CHF. J. Brown did an admirable job last year.

* the return of Keating, now McDonald has emerged as a force. Probably have Keating floating around the forward line - may even play them on the paddock at the same time?

* seeing S. Lawrence in action against his old teammates - shirtfront anyone?

* Luke Power continuing to outperform all other small forwards, more possessions, goals & assists than anyone & still all the press goes to Farmer!

* Chris Johnson, flying the flag for the Roys. Correct me if I'm wrong, but isnt he the only one left?
